mcberko (47456) reviewed Mont Rouge Cuvée Classique from Vins Arista 6 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 7 | Flavor - 8 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 8
Bottle sample at Mondial des Cidres, pours a clear golden, no head. Aroma brings out caramel-covered apples, gentle toffee and brown sugar. Flavour is decadent, with treacle toffee, brown sugar and caramel apples. Sweet but not cloying. Wonderfully done.

Metalchopz (7978) reviewed Dublin's Pub Dry Hop from Vins Arista 7 years ago
Appearance - 2 | Aroma - 5 | Flavor - 5 | Texture - 4 | Overall - 5
Found at a local Metro store. Pours a clear, very light yellow-gold colour with a fizzy head that dissipates quite quickly. No lace of course. Aromas are mild, but with real pressed apples. The taste is quite mild as well. Not syrupy, not sweet, just a little fruity. There is a tad hops in there changing slightly the taste. Still not too dry as some ciders, especially with the dry hopping. Interesting, but nothing to go back to.

Weihenweizen (7385) reviewed Pomme de Coeur from Vins Arista 8 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 7 | Flavor - 8 | Texture - 6 | Overall - 8
Refrigerated 375 ml clear bottle corked poured into a white wine glass. Clear Amber with very little off-white head, no carbonation, medium/thick body, and very little lacing. Taste is rich semi-sweet apples and honey. Very nice cider.
